Muscat: The official price of Omani crude oil for July delivery was set at $104.17 per barrel on Friday, May 1, 2026, marking a daily decline, according to data released in Muscat.

The price fell by $3.03 per barrel compared with the previous trading day. Despite the drop, Oman's crude has seen strong gains in recent months. The average price for May delivery stood at $124.05 per barrel, an increase of $55.90 from April's delivery price.

Omani crude is considered a key benchmark for oil exports from the Middle East to Asia, and its movements are closely watched by global energy markets.
